Output e07f5a4e54bf8c18b46b0721b0c921e0fb5ffb9b9bfc798b685f362e2798511e:6

value
1594269
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58ba6ca94addbd086d7113ddf80a1fe654bbad14cfcb9b0c7442f6378e70dc89
address
tb1ptzaxe222mk7ssmt3z0wlszslue2thtg5el9ekrr5gtmr0rnsmjysptgw5c
transaction
e07f5a4e54bf8c18b46b0721b0c921e0fb5ffb9b9bfc798b685f362e2798511e
spent
true